Meeting notes — Fixtureforge test-data factory. Agreed to freeze the v1 factory API; new trait-based builders go in a v2 namespace. Seeded-random defaults stay, but the seed must now be logged in test output for reproducibility. Deprecation warnings land next sprint; removal no earlier than two releases out. Maintainers should document migration steps in the wiki. Ownership of the migration plan sits with the engineer named below.

named custodian: Holael Lamwyn

FareMatrix — Environment Variables. FM_RULE_SOURCE: rules bundle path. FM_CACHE_TTL: seconds, default 300. FM_ZONE_MODE: strict or lenient. FM_LOG_LEVEL: info recommended. Support note: "fee mismatch" tickets are usually a stale cache; lower FM_CACHE_TTL before escalating. The engine also needs a credential to pull signed rule bundles from the publisher; without it, bundles fail verification. That credential goes in the env file on this line:

env line for fafof-fahag: LEDGER_TOKEN5=f8790

## Sensor drift: what to do at 3am

If the GrowLoop controller starts reporting humidity swings that don't match the backup probes in the Fernwick greenhouse, it's almost always sensor drift, not an actual climate event. Don't panic and don't touch the vents manually. First, restart the calibration daemon and give it ten minutes to re-baseline. If readings still disagree by more than 5%, flip the controller into safe mode. The safe-mode thresholds it will use are these.

config for yahap-bajof:
[istix]
host = istix.qorvelsys.internal
user = istix_svc
database = istix_prod

To: release channel
From: Pemberlane greenhouse team

Welcome aboard. Quick context: the Fernhollow controller's humidity sensors drift upward roughly 2% per week, so the 1.8 patch adds weekly auto-recalibration against the reference probe. Don't trust raw readings older than seven days in any dashboard. Patch is staged on the test rig; soak runs clean for 48 hours. The staging build's token is directly below.

session token of tajef-bageg = htk21_5d90d574934f3ccae6437